摘要
Brucella abortus is a facultative intracellular parasite that promotes its own internalization in nonphagocytic cells. The bacterium initially interacts with compartments of the early endocytic cascade, then rapidly segregates from this intracellular pathway and associates with the autophagocytic cascade. During the late stages of infection, Brucella proliferates within the endoplasmic reticulum of host cells. (C) 2000 Editions scientifiques et medicales Elsevier SAS.
